πŸ“ The Sweet History of Cheesecake

Cheesecake has a long and fascinating history that dates back thousands of years. Ancient Greeks are believed to have served early forms of cheesecake to athletes during the first Olympic Games. Over time, cheesecake recipes spread throughout Europe and eventually became a beloved dessert in America.

Modern no-bake cheesecake became especially popular during the 20th century because it was quicker, easier, and required no oven. Adding fruit toppings like strawberries became a favorite way to bring freshness, color, and natural sweetness to the creamy dessert.

Today, strawberry cheesecake is one of the world’s most loved dessert flavors, inspiring cakes, cookies, ice cream, milkshakes, candies, and these adorable cheesecake bites.

πŸ›’ Ingredients

For the Cheesecake Bites

  • 1 box Honey Maid graham crackers, broken into squares
  • 1 tub Philadelphia No-Bake Cheesecake Filling
  • 1 can Duncan Hines Strawberry Pie Filling & Topping
  • 1 cup fresh strawberries, sliced

πŸ“ Step-by-Step Instructions

Step 1: Prepare the Graham Crackers

Break the graham crackers carefully into individual squares. Arrange them evenly on a serving tray, platter, or baking sheet lined with parchment paper.

Make sure the crackers are flat and stable so the toppings stay neatly in place.


Step 2: Add the Cheesecake Filling

Using a spoon or piping bag, place about 1–2 tablespoons of cheesecake filling onto each graham cracker square.

Spread gently with the back of a spoon or pipe into decorative swirls for a bakery-style appearance.

The creamy layer acts as the rich cheesecake center of each bite.


Step 3: Add the Strawberry Topping

Spoon a small amount of strawberry pie filling over the cheesecake layer.

Be careful not to overload the crackers so they remain easy to pick up and eat.

Add slices of fresh strawberries on top for extra freshness, color, and juicy flavor.


Step 4: Chill the Cheesecake Bites

Place the tray into the refrigerator for about 20–30 minutes.

This chilling step helps the cheesecake filling firm slightly and allows the flavors to blend beautifully.


Step 5: Serve and Enjoy

Serve cold for the best texture and flavor.

3. Frozen Cheesecake Bite Method

Freeze the bites for 1–2 hours for a frozen cheesecake treat.

The texture becomes creamy like cheesecake ice cream sandwiches.

πŸ“ Flavor Variations

Blueberry Cheesecake Bites

Replace strawberry topping with blueberry pie filling.

Cherry Cheesecake Bites

Use cherry pie filling and fresh cherries.

Tropical Cheesecake Bites

Add pineapple topping and toasted coconut.

Chocolate Strawberry Cheesecake Bites

Drizzle melted chocolate over the finished bites.

Lemon Strawberry Cheesecake Bites

Add lemon zest for a bright citrus flavor.

πŸ“ Storage Tips

  • Store in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
  • Keep chilled until serving time.
  • Avoid stacking them to maintain their appearance.
  • Freezing is possible, though the crackers may soften slightly after thawing.

πŸ“ Helpful Dessert Tips

βœ… Use cold cheesecake filling for easier spreading
βœ… Pat fresh strawberries dry to prevent sogginess
βœ… Chill before serving for best texture
βœ… Add toppings just before serving for freshness
βœ… Use sturdy graham crackers to hold toppings well
